I Calipop are presented as a five-member Roman beat group active around 1966–1967. They favored a gentler beat style and recorded Italian-language covers, notably of a Rolling Stones song and an Endrigo song. The review praises moments of the performances (notably the central parts) but criticizes rushed arrangements and uneven expression; overall rating 3/5.
